QJ reader mikeall tipped us about this... this... mother-load of homebrew apps, games, flash games and more. It made all of us gasped "Madre de Dios!" upon gazing at its content. But be warned. Indigo 1.3 is not for the faint of heart. This monstrous German package weighs in a hefty 87MB! Maybe your PSP can handle that much. Question is can you?
It has at least a dozen programs:
* Pocket calculators (normal and Flash)
* Calendars (normal and Flash)
* File Loader
* Magic 8 ball
* Lamp
* PSPMail
* Stop clock
* HTML DEAD pixel more cleaner
* Alarm bell
* Flash world clock
* Fast Google/Yahoo/Abacho support
* ICQ/AIM/MSN/Yahoo! mobile - support

PSP Action Replay converter is a simple application designed to convert the code file of PSP Action Replay into CWCheat or nitePR format. This application is currently only capable of converting ~80% of codes correctly to CWCheat format so I need as much help as possible as I am stuck with some of the more complicated codes
